Sister Nivedita by Sumit Kumar

Nivedita was born in Tyron city of North Ireland on October 23, 1867. Her ancestors were originally the citizens of Scotland and had come to settle in Ireland. Her father, Samuel Nobel, and mother, Lady Hamilton, remained childless for several years after their marriage. They prayed to God for a child. They promised that they would dedicate the child to the service of God. When she was born, her parents gave her the name—Margaret Elizabeth Nobel.
Nivedita’s family were religious by nature. Therefore, it was natural for Nivedita to be influenced by religious belief. Since her childhood, she used to go out with her father to serve the poor.
Since her childhood days, serving the needy and the poor had become an intrinsic part of her personality. She had received nationalistic inspiration from her father and grandfather. Similarly, she had inherited beauty and humility from her mother.
